The railway transportation, which started in 1866 in our country, has been carried out for many years by vehicles that are all imported and whose maintenance and repairs are carried out in an externally dependent manner.

This situation has constantly caused problems and cuts in railway operations and increased costs. The first facilities of TÜVASAŞ were put into operation on October 25, 1951 under the name of “Wagon Repair Workshop” in order to eliminate these problems.

The company was converted into Adapazarı Railway Factory (ADF) since 1961 and the first wagon was produced in 1962.

As a result of the export activities started in 1971, a total of 77 wagons were exported to Pakistan and Bangladesh.

In 1975, the production of RIC type passenger wagons in international standards started at the facilities named “Adapazarı Wagon Industry Organization ADV (ADVAS).

Starting from 1976, production of electric suburban series started with the license of Alstom Company and total 75 series (225 units) were produced and delivered to TCDD.

In the 1986 winning status Today Turkey Wagon Industry Corporation (TÜVASAŞ), passenger cars, as well as research and development of electric range of manufacturing and engineering services for new projects has given density by making breakthroughs in their fields.

The projects produced during 1990 years have been matured and the design of TÜVASAŞ Rail Buses, new RIC-Z type luxury wagons and TVS 2000 air-conditioned luxury wagon projects have been completed and their production has started in 1994.

In 1995, infrastructure works were accelerated for the production of vehicles used in light rail transportation.

In 1998, TÜVASAŞ started to provide quality services in the production and repair of wagons with its experienced experts, engineers and qualified workers, and successfully completed the production of TVS 2000 type luxury bed wagons.

TÜVASAŞ, 17 August 1999 suffered enormous material damage in the Marmara Earthquake. The workshops and infrastructure of the organization, which lost the production capability, became unusable, repair and production were completely stopped.

Debris removal works started in April of 2000 and with the great efforts of TÜVASAŞ personnel, re-manufacturing and repair activities were started in a short time.

In 2001, within the framework of cooperation with SIEMENS, assembly and commissioning of 38 vehicle of Bursa Metropolitan Municipality Light Rail Vehicle fleet was carried out at TÜVASAŞ facilities.

Since the year 2002, the M-Series (M10 pulman, M70 food and M80 personnel division) modernization wagon projects have been realized in order to bring the old type wagons to a modern appearance and comfort in a modern way with a modular approach.

In the recent years, TÜVASAŞ has accelerated the export of wagons abroad, and generator wagons for Iraqi Railways, which were manufactured in 2005, were delivered on May 28. Thus, TÜVASAŞ has regained its identity as a company capable of exporting after 2006 year.

In the year 2008, enterprise resource planning (ERP) application, which enables monitoring and control of all business activities in computer environment, was introduced.

In the years 2008 and 2009, the 84 (28 set) metro vehicle to be operated by Istanbul Metropolitan Municipality between Taksim and Yenikapı and the 75 (25 set) electric train set (suburban) vehicles of TCDD were manufactured within the framework of joint production with Hyundai / Rotem company of South Korea. .

The project titled destekleme Investigation of Passenger Wagons Under Static and Dynamic Loads X was accepted by TÜBİTAK within the scope of the support program of public institutions research projects in 2007; Computerized stress analysis of passenger wagons, high speed collision and comfort tests in road conditions made it possible to report. In addition, since the year 2009 static test stand on the products are tested.

In 2010, a multi-voltage energy supply unit (UIC voltage converter) to be used in European railways was manufactured and tested under road conditions.

In 2010, “Climatic Test Tunnel” construction was started in cooperation with Sakarya University, Uludağ University and TÜVASAŞ to test the air conditioning systems of rail vehicles and this application was presented to TÜBİTAK.

Diesel Train Set (DMU) vehicles project, which started production in 2010; It consists of a total of 12 vehicles, 3 of which are 12 and 4 of which are 84. The production of these vehicles until the end of 2013 was completed and delivered to TCDD.

In 2010, production of 275 vehicle for Marmaray Project within the framework of joint production with Hyundai / Rotem company has been started in our facilities in accordance with the contract.
